The 1997 Dodge Neon, part of the first generation (PG), is an entry-level compact car celebrated for its distinctive cab-forward design, surprisingly spacious interior, and sporty appeal. Engineered with a focus on value and youthful dynamics, it competed effectively against rivals like the Honda Civic and Toyota Corolla. This model offered fuel-efficient engines, including the 2.0L SOHC producing 132 horsepower, and was available with either a 5-speed manual or a 4-speed automatic transmission. Key features such as rack-and-pinion steering and independent front suspension contributed to its agile handling, making it a notable choice for drivers seeking an engaging yet practical vehicle.
